Sampson wrote: Mon Aug 11, 2025 5:00 pm Duckweed's easy to trim—just scoop out what you don't want. But good luck keeping it under control, haha. That stuff spreads like wildfire.
True story. If you're gonna mess with Duckweed, be ready to scoop it weekly. It's like the glitter of the aquarium world.

If you're into floaters, try Frogbit instead. It's easier to manage, and the roots look awesome. Just trim the roots if they get too long.

Frogbit's a solid choice. Salvinia's another good one—it's easy to thin out by hand, and it doesn't go nuts like Duckweed.
